Hi            There,

I had problem to send fax to a particular number via our H323 gateway. The call was dropped after 15 seconds, when I call the number from normal IP phone, it took 20 seconds to hear the fax tones. Since we can not change the fax machine settings, is it possible to change some setting on the CUCM or gateway to fix the problem?

I checked the ISDN timer settings on the call manager and could not find anything useful.

Here is part of the isdn q931 debug.      

 

Jul 27 09:49:14.185 AEST: ISDN Se0/0/1:15 Q931: RX <- CALL_PROC pd = 8  callref = 0x8595

Channel ID i = 0xA9839F

  Exclusive, Channel 31

Jul 27 09:49:14.841 AEST: ISDN Se0/0/1:15 Q931: RX <- ALERTING pd = 8  callref = 0x8595

Progress Ind i = 0x8488 - In-band info or appropriate now available 

Progress Ind i = 0x8482 - Destination address is non-ISDN

Jul 27 09:49:29.849 AEST: ISDN Se0/0/1:15 Q931: TX -> DISCONNECT pd = 8  callref = 0x0595

Cause i = 0x80A9 - Temporary failure

Jul 27 09:49:29.913 AEST: ISDN Se0/0/1:15 Q931: RX <- RELEASE pd = 8  callref = 0x8595

Jul 27 09:49:29.913 AEST: ISDN Se0/0/1:15 Q931: TX -> RELEASE_COMP pd = 8  callref = 0x0595

Check that possibly  is your calling fax that disconnects after 15 seconds, so you have to work on it, not on the CUCM.

Thank you for your reply, we just found another 2 numbers had the same problem, when I call from normal phone, it is ok, it is like "fax server-- CUCM -- voice gateway -- PSTN -- fax machine", from the fax server, I ran the wireshark debug and can see that the CUCM sent the relesae to the fax server, and did not see any release from the fax machine.

If my understanding is correct, T301 in CUCM is the timer manage the timeout for this, and it is set as 180 seconds, which make me confused

Can you take the same trace again, but only adding "debug vpm signal" ?

That will show if calling fax goes back to on-hook prematurely, as I suspect.
